What’s a Garden Sculpture?
Let’s start with garden sculptures. You’ve probably seen these in all sorts of gardens, from small backyard ones to big public parks. A garden sculpture is basically a standalone piece of art that’s placed in a garden setting. It’s like a little work of art that adds a touch of personality and style to the outdoor space.
These sculptures come in all shapes and sizes. You might have a small, cute statue of a gnome or a big, imposing bronze figure of a mythological creature. They can be made from all kinds of materials, too, like stone, metal, wood, or even fiberglass.
The main purpose of a garden sculpture is to be a focal point. It draws your eye and becomes a conversation starter. For example, if you have a beautiful marble statue of a Greek goddess in the middle of your flower bed, people are going to stop and take a look. It’s like a little piece of art that makes your garden more interesting and unique.
What is a Sculptural Landscape?
Now, let’s talk about sculptural landscapes. This is where things get a bit more complex. A sculptural landscape isn’t just one single piece of art; it’s a whole outdoor space that’s been designed and created to be like a work of art.
Think of it as a combination of nature and art. Instead of just placing a statue in a garden, a sculptural landscape involves shaping the land, adding different elements like rocks, water features, and plants, and creating a cohesive design that flows together.
For example, you might have a large area of land that’s been turned into a series of rolling hills, with paths winding through them. Along the paths, there are strategically placed boulders, and in the low – lying areas, there are small ponds with water lilies. The whole thing is designed to look like a living, breathing work of art.
One of the key features of a sculptural landscape is that it’s interactive. You’re not just looking at it from a distance; you’re walking through it, experiencing it. It’s like being inside a giant sculpture. And because it’s made up of so many different elements, it can change over time. The plants will grow and change with the seasons, and the water in the ponds will move and reflect the light in different ways.
Key Differences
Scale and Scope
The most obvious difference between a garden sculpture and a sculptural landscape is the scale. A garden sculpture is usually a single, relatively small object. It can be easily moved around and placed in different parts of the garden. On the other hand, a sculptural landscape is a large – scale project that often covers a significant amount of land. It requires a lot of planning and resources to create.
Design and Function
A garden sculpture is mainly about aesthetics. It’s designed to look good and add a decorative element to the garden. While it can have some symbolic meaning, its primary function is to be a visual attraction.
A sculptural landscape, however, has a more complex design and function. It’s not just about looking good; it’s about creating an experience. It can be used for relaxation, meditation, or even as an educational space. For example, a sculptural landscape might be designed to teach people about different types of plants or the importance of water conservation.
Permanence
Garden sculptures can be quite portable. You can move them around your garden or even take them with you if you move house. They’re relatively easy to install and remove.
Sculptural landscapes, on the other hand, are much more permanent. Once they’re created, it’s not easy to change them. They involve a lot of earth – moving, construction, and planting, so any major changes would require a significant amount of work.
